Frzninvt Posted June 21, 2007 Share Posted June 21, 2007 Dave, I surely under-utilize mine I use it exclusively to enhance/improve the audio signal coming from my Digital Satellite Dish receiver. Many channels are highly compressed the the DBX unit brings them back to life restoring the sparkle to the highs and the immediacy to the effects making things much more realistic sounding. When used in conjuction with it's sister unit the 120X-DS Subharmonic Synthesizer/Electronic Crossover it is tough combination to beat. A cool thing to try that works really well and gives you independent channel control is to use two 4BX units, since the DBX VCA's (Voltage Controlled Amplifier's) are mono triggered I used some good "Y" adapters and dedicated a unit to each channel. The soundstage and presentation improved quite a bit and you can adjust the channels independent of one another. I have done this with 4BX's, 3BX-DS's (my favorite combo), and 5BX-DS's. The 5BX-DS is more of a downward expander and does not expand upwards unless the signal is greater than 7dbV which is not that common. Their gear was very well built and I have never had any noise or anomolies in my system when using the older DBX consumer group gear.
